This Where's Where article is an attempt at establishing geographical facts about Ghyll; it does not record other facts. For example, it records that the Evesque Valley is well-irrigated (and therefore must have plenty of streams), but it does not record that it used to play host to Aelfants.

The Facts
- Alezan (land) (on map: yes)
- Is heavily forested (Alezan)
- Uninhabited, thus no other towns (Alezan)
- Situated to the west of the Evesque Valley (Alezan)
- Most prominent feature: ruins with a twin-spire structure (Alezan)
- @@ Situated close to the Vale of Serdoch (Bordingbras his hatt!)
 
- Andelphracian River Valley (valley) (on map: yes)
- Is not in the Evesque Valley or Sarfelogian Mountains (Carsokian)
 
- Arbuckle Hill (hill) (on map: no, too small)
- Situated in Folktown (Cadaver, The)
- Host to the Cadaver public house (Cadaver, The)
 
- Avazian Ruins (building)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Possibly in a wasteland (Avazian Box)
 
- Avaz Minor (city) (on map: yes)
- Suspected to be located at the center of the Shallow Gulf (Dagger Seas)
- Ancient city; detonation point of Justice Device during the Third Avazian War (Dagger Seas)
 
- Azura Mines (mines) (on map: yes)
- Situated by the city of Iganefta (Altoxian Bulb)
 
- Baleman (building) (on map: yes)
- Ruined in an earthquake (Baleman)
- Situated on the northern edge of the Evesque Valley (Baleman)
 
- Bute (university/town) (on map: yes)
- The Timperton Clocktower is on campus (Bute University)
- Contains three lakes, a forest, and blasted moorland (Bute University)
 
- Cactus Forests (on map: yes)
- A rarely travelled land (Cactus forests)
- Located in the deserts of the southern end of Ghyll (Cactus forests)
 
- Cake (building) (on map: no, too small)
- Situated on the side of a valley by the hamlet of Odlucia (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
 
- Cataract Road (road) (on map: yes)
- Has waterfalls alongside it (Burnflies)
- Starts in the north of the Evesque Valley (Cataract Road)
- Runs through Cranee and Folktown (Cataract Road)
- Ends in the southern town of Iganefta (Cataract Road)
- In the foothills of Mount Yurch it is built on the Yérplat Ridge. (Plain of Brahang)
- At the Plain of Brahang it follows an old road that has been there as early as -400 EC (Plain of Brahang)
 
- Charterhouse Estate (estate) (on map: no, too small)
- On the outskirts of Folktown (Charterhouse Collection)
 
- Cranee (hamlet) (on map: yes)
- Situated to the north of the Vale of Serdoch (Battle of Barnum Stones)
- The Battle of Barnum Stones probably took place 25 lele south (Battle of Barnum Stones)
- Directly between the Evesque Valley and Folktown (Cranee Historical Society)
- 25 sugro-nanits from the Evesque Valley (Cranee Historical Society)
- 18 sugro-nanits from Folktown (Cranee Historical Society)
- Has a village green (Cranee Historical Society)
 
- Dagger Peninsulas (peninsulas) (on map: yes)
- Creates the dagger-like freshwater points of the Dagger Seas (Dagger Seas)
 
- Dagger Seas (seas) (on map: yes)
- A haunt of the well-known Captain Riquiras (Captain Riquiras)
- Four massive estuaries: Primus, Segundus, Tertius, and Marty (Dagger Seas)
- Broad mouths at the gulf tapering to dagger-like freshwater points (Dagger Seas)
- The freshwater points are where the Dagger Peninsulas join the mainland (Dagger Seas)
- The seas are calm, though they are affected by the tides (Dagger Seas)
- The Marty Sea contains Kebro-shepenor, a small island (Kebro-shepenor)
 
- Dŵplat (stream) (on map: yes)

- Elminster Mire (mire) (on map: yes)
- Known to exist at the time of Quezlar 6 (Andelphracian Lights)
- Ghyll-wide environmental crisis: ongoing stillicide in the Mire (Doc Rockett)
- Located east of the Evesque Valley and northwest of the Andelphracian River Valley (Elminster Mire)
 
- Egron (town) (on map: yes)
- Situated close to Folktown (Bindlet Ball)
- Located northeast of Folktown, east of the town of Sejfeld (Egron)
 
- Evesque Valley (valley) (on map: yes)
- Is picturesque (Bavarian Creame)
- Is well-irrigated (Adlorst Vinifera)
- Contains quayres (Andelphracian Lights)
- Is situated in the north of Ghyll (Cataract Road)
- Situated to the east of the land of Alezan (Alezan)
- A fault-line runs under the northern edge (Baleman)
- The northen edge has a relatively unpopulated area (Baleman)
- Fluyr may be the name of something in the north (Baleman)
- Divided into three sections, upper, mid, and lower ((Evesque Valley)
- 25 sugro-nanits from the hamlet of Cranee (Cranee Historical Society)
- Contains plantations (Adlorst Vinifera), e.g. of Sphoxolis Trees (Besq Boats)
- Contains the Seven Lakes of Midevesque (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ge & Evesque Valley)
 
- Folktown (city) (on map: yes)
- Is a city (Amphitheatre aristocracy)
- Contains Arbuckle Hill (Cadaver, The)
- Contains the Laureat House (Calends Gala)
- Situated close to the town of Egron (Bindlet Ball)
- Has a town square (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
- Contains an amphitheatre (Amphitheatre aristocracy)
- Ten sugro-nanits south-east of Marsh Gibbon (Bavarian Creame)
- 18 sugro-nanits from the hamlet of Cranee (Cranee Historical Society)
- Contains the Folktown Hyperbolic Bindlet Ball Arena (Day of Champions)
- The outskirts are home to the Charterhouse Estate (Charterhouse Collection)
- Has a Grand Mall 'twixt the Folktown Council Hall and Folktown Amphitheatre (Bavarian Creame)
 
- Fundzherit Peninsula (peninsula)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Had some theoalchemical incident (inferred) (Doc Rockett)
 
- Fylesgate (town) (on map: no, not yet)
- Possibly in the Evesque Valley (Andelphracian Lights)
 
- Glossfordshire (town) (on map: yes)
- Involved heavily in Bindlet Ball (Bindlet Ball)
 
- Iganefta (city) (on map: yes)
- Situated by the Azura Mines (Altoxian Bulb)
- Is situated in the south of Ghyll (Cataract Road)
- A city comprised of many smaller settlements (Altoxian Bulb)
- Is divided into upper and lower class sections (Altoxian Bulb)
- Two leles away from the Azura Mines (Iganefta)
- 120 leles away from Mount Yurch (Iganefta)
- Iganefta-on-the-Sea is 30 leles away (Iganefta)
- Contains Memorial Garden and Brothers monastery (NeoAlezanians)
 
- Iganefta-on-the-Sea (city) (on map: yes)
- 30 leles away from Iganefta (Iganefta)
- Was once the fishing village of Thunderbarg (Lord Glosfordshier)
 
- Jorvyll (region) (on map: yes)
- Moutainous region north of the Evesque Valley (Keglacians)
 
- Kebro-shepenor (island) (on map: yes)
- Located in Marty, one of the four Dagger Seas (Kebro-shepenor)
- At low tide, connected to Shepenor by a sandbar (Kebro-shepenor)
 
- Marsh Gibbon (town) (on map: yes)
- Situated near the town of Sejfeld (Bavarian Creame)
- Ten sugro-nanits north-west of Folktown (Bavarian Creame)
 
- Mount Rotyg (mountain) (on map: no, not yet)
- About 4,000 nanits smaller than Mount Yurch (Mount Yurch)
- Is the second tallest mountain in Ghyll (Mount Yurch)
 
- Mount Yurch (mountain) (on map: yes)
- About 120 lele west of Iganefta (Grommies)
- Is 18,764 nanits tall (Mount Yurch)
- Is the tallest mountain in Ghyll (Mount Yurch)
 
- Odlucia (hamlet) (on map: yes)
- Situated in a valley (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
- Is surrounded by many farmsteads (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
- Contains the Odlucian Library and the Bureau's Cake (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
 
- Odlucian Library (building) (on map: yes)
- Is an active library (Anaximancer)
- Situated on the side of a valley by Odlucia (Bureau of Forgotten Knowledge)
 
- Palace of Lost Souls (building)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Building of a location not yet recorded (Alarius)
 
- Pinky and Perky (astrological) (above map: yes)
- The moons of Ghyll (Cranee Historical Society)
 
- Plain of Brahang (plain) (on map: yes)
- Location of the Brahang Turnpike Inn (Plain of Brahang)
- Formerly the location of a turnpike.
- 1250 square sugro-nanits in size (Plain of Brahang)
- 800 lele northwest of Iganefta (Plain of Brahang)
- Bordered to the north by the Qestarius River (Plain of Brahang)
- Bordered to the south by the Yérplat Ridge which is now the Cataract Road (Plain of Brahang)
- The battle of the Aelfant coprolith took place here (Conflict That Is Not Happening)
 
- Principality of Jurra (town; maybe more) (on map: yes)
- The Harrabloon Bank mints coins for them (Harrabloon Bank)
- Presumably nearby Folktown, as its press affects them (Harrabloon Bank)
 
- River Ocean (ocean) (on map: yes)
- The Dagger Seas and Shallow Gulf empty into it (Opoudelian Starker)
 
- Qestarius River (river) (on map: yes)
- Borders the north edge of the Plain of Brahang (Plain of Brahang)
- The major tributary to the Dagger Sea (Plain of Brahang)
 
- Sarfelogian Mountains (mountains) (on map: yes)
- Its foothills have plantations (Adlorst Vinifera)
- Ghyll-wide environmental crisis: destruction of the mountain meadows (Doc Rockett)
- Po Mountain is located within this range (Heh-blammo balance)
 
- Sayaziha or City of Spheres (city)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Said to have been seen by Ibaan Malmiz (Grimporke Grimoire)
 
- Sejfeld (town) (on map: yes)
- Situated near the town of Marsh Gibbon (Bavarian Creame)
 
- Shallow Gulf (gulf) (on map: yes)
- The four Dagger Seas empty into it (Dagger Seas)
- Dominates the western edge of our continent (Dagger Seas)
- The Gulf is calm, though is affected by the tides (Dagger Seas)
- Center of the Gulf is likely to have been site of ancient city of Avaz Minor (Dagger Seas)
 
- Shepenor (fishing village) (on map: yes)
- Near, or on, the coast of Marty, one of the Dagger Seas (Kebro-shepenor)
- Kebro-shepenor is within sight of Shepenor, but too far to swim (Kebro-shepenor)
- At low tide, connected to Kebro-shepenor by a sandbar (Kebro-shepenor)
 
- Spacial Clocktower, The (clocktower)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Unfindable (Cartographer's Nerves)
 
- Stindersgrough (town) (on map: yes)
- Home of the Barnum Stones (Battle of Barnum Stones)
 
- Threel (town?) (on map: no, unknown location)
- Location unknown, circa -249 EC (Extraordinarily Bloodless Revolution)
- Probably near the Palace of Lost Souls, also location unknown (Extraordinarily Bloodless Revolution)
 
- Thungerbarg (village) (on map: yes)
- Former name of Iganefta-on-the-Sea; still in use among some residents.
 
- Umbo Moor (moor) (on map: yes)
- @@ In-between or nearby (?) Egron and Marsh Gibbon (Edvard von Craghelm)
 
- Undivaggen (building) (on map: no, too small)
- Situated in the town of Marsh Gibbon (Bavarian Creame)
 
- Vale of Serdoch (vale) (on map: yes)
- Situated just to the south of Cranee (Battle of Barnum Stones)
- @@ Situated close to the ruins of Alezan (Bordingbras his hatt!)
 
- Wentzel Fen (fen) (on map: yes)
- @@ In-between or nearby (?) Egron and Marsh Gibbon (Edvard von Craghelm)
 
- Yérplat Ridge (ridge) (on map: yes)
- Better known as the Cataract Road these days (Plain of Brahang)
